Eagles Fall Short in Slugfest to the Spartans
5/10/2017 7:10:00 PM | Baseball
EMU had its best offensive output in 10 games
EAST LANSING, Mich. (EMUEagles.com) – Despite a surge in the offense, the Eastern Michigan University baseball team could not keep pace in an 11-6 defeat Wednesday afternoon, May 10, at McLane Stadium. It was the most runs scored by EMU (18-31) in 10 games.
Eastern cranked out 12 hits, which tied the output of the Spartans (26-19). It was Eastern's first double-digit hitting game since April 18 against Oakland University. Three Eagles recorded multi-hit games, led by a career-high three-hit day from sophomore John Rensel Jr. (Tallmadge, Ohio-Tallmadge), including a double and an RBI. It was his first multi-hit game of the season.
Elsewhere, senior John Montgomery (Anaheim Hills, Calif.-JSerra) had a two-hit day, including his team-leading 10th homer of the season, a solo homer, as well as a double. It was the 18th dinger of his EMU career, placing him in a tie for 22nd all-time. Redshirt senior Marquise Gill (Paw Paw, Mich.-Paw Paw) also had a two-hit, two-RBI day, knocking in a pair on two singles. Finally, fellow senior Jeremy Stidham (Colorado Springs, Colo.-Sand Creek (Colby C.C.)) had a productive day, smacking a triple and drawing two walks, while scoring two of EMU's runs. It was his second triple of the season, and sixth of his EMU career.
The first two innings went by with no scoring, despite both teams leaving a few runners on base. The tie was broken in the third though, as MSU smoked a three-run home run to right field, making it 3-0 after three innings.
EMU got the bats going in the fourth, springing for a pair of runs on a trio of hits. A leadoff walk to Stidham, followed by a single from freshman Zachary Owings (Saline, Mich.-Saline) made it two on, no outs. After a groundout advanced the runners, Rensel ripped his second hit of the day, a single to right center, to score Stidham. The very next pitch, Gill singled to center, scoring Owings from third, and putting the tally at 3-2.
After a clean bottom of the fourth, the Spartans busted the game open in the fifth with five runs on four hits, including a three-run double, making it 8-2 midway through the contest.
Eastern chipped away at the lead in the top of the sixth, getting two more runs on three more hits. A single from Nick Jones (Battle Creek, Mich.-Lakeview) and a double from Rensel made it second and third for Gill. The senior cranked his second RBI single of the day, scoring the first. The next batter, freshman Devin Hager (Commerce Township, Mich.-Walled Lake Northern), knocked in the other on an RBI groundout, making it a four-run game, 8-4.
The Spartans had the immediate response though, getting the two runs back plus another, making it 11-4 after six frames. EMU would not go away quietly though, getting another two-run inning in the seventh.
Montgomery got the first run all on his own, as he smoked a solo home run into the river in right field. The next batter, Stidham, followed that up with a triple in the gap, and scored on a sacrifice fly from Owings, quickly making it an 11-6 ballgame. It was the sixth triple of Stidham's career, placing him in 21st place in the EMU record books.
Despite three scoreless innings down the stretch from the bullpen, including 2.2 from sophomore James Harness (Huber Heights, Ohio-Wayne), EMU's bats were held scoreless in the eighth and ninth to seal the 11-6 defeat.
